Course Description

Cybersecurity Essentials is a foundational course designed to provide students with the knowledge and practical skills needed to protect digital systems, networks, applications, and data from cyber threats. The course covers core cybersecurity concepts including network security, ethical hacking, threat analysis, security operations, cryptography, cloud security, and incident response.

Students will gain hands-on experience with cybersecurity tools, vulnerability assessments, security monitoring, and defensive techniques used by security professionals. The course prepares learners to understand modern cyber threats and implement effective security controls in organizations.

Through practical labs, simulations, and real-world case studies, students will develop the skills required for entry-level cybersecurity roles and advanced security studies.
